Power Curves, Plateaus, Growth Hacking and More – Ask a Cycling Coach 264 by TrainerRoad published on 2020-06-25T23:04:04Z Learn how to analyze your power curve to help direct your training, what to do to end a plateau in your fitness, a deep dive into if training your ability to handle a higher cognitive load will make you faster and more in Episode 264 of The Ask a Cycling Coach Podcast. ---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- TOPICS COVERED IN THIS EPISODE: • How to push past plateaus in your fitness • Why you don’t need to train as long as your goal events • How to train weaknesses in your power curve • Tubeless setups tips for MTB to road • Training your ability to handle a higher cognitive load • How to get structured workouts with TrainerRoad on a budget • How to figure out how much to increase your FTP to progress your training More training questions answered here: bit.ly/Training-Questions-Help-Center ---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- THE ONLY PODCAST DEDICATED TO MAKING YOU A FASTER CYCLIST Each week Coach Chad Timmerman, Coach Jonathan and TrainerRoad’s CEO Nate Pearson gather to answer queries submitted from athletes around the globe, as well as dish about their latest training experiments, discoveries and tips.
